East Hampshire There is an active Domestic Abuse Forum, but it is not easy to find out about. Petersfield, Hazlemere, and Bordon have no support either general or specialist. Petersfield has The Kings Arms Youth Group but it is more of an afterschool club than advice service. Alton is served by the SDAS but this is only through 3 day summer camps for young people and one freedom programme for women. This district has a high level of antisocial behaviour and so it is likely that need for DA support is there.

Fareham and Gosport It appears there is a Domestic Abuse Forum in this area, although the website is very out of date and so makes it difficult to see if it still runs. Catch 22 is a catch all11 service that used to have a number of projects but due to funding this has been limited to a handful – none of which are DA specific. It is an open, drop in service which seems to work well and does result in a number of disclosures. There is an IDVA trained member of staff, but other than that there is little other localised specialist support. Organisation Catch 22 (Young Women’s Support Service) Fareham & Gosport Family
